titleOfInvention Method and apparatus for mass spectrometry
abstract (57) [Summary] [Object] An object of the present invention is to provide a method and apparatus for mass spectrometry in which the manufacturing cost of an interface is reduced. [Structure] Ions generated under atmospheric pressure are the first, second, third After passing through the vacuum chambers 4 and 6 separated by the pores 3, 5 and 7, they are guided to the MS section 8 for mass analysis. The first vacuum chamber 4 is adjacent to the atmospheric pressure portion, there is no vacuum pump for independently evacuating this chamber, and the bypass hole 26 provided in the wall having the second fine hole 5 is provided. After that, the gas is exhausted together with the second vacuum chamber 6 by a common pump. The pressure in the first vacuum chamber 4 can be set to several 100 Pa, and the pressure in the second vacuum chamber 6 can be set to several 10 Pa. In the first vacuum chamber 4, it is possible to achieve sufficient desolvation at an ion acceleration voltage of about 100 V and then suppress the spread of the velocity. Second In the vacuum chamber 6, the ions are accelerated at about 10 V and the spread of velocity can be suppressed as low as possible.
